Mackenzies View, Family Beach House In Tamarama With DA approved plans for a New Modern Architectual Masterpiece

Tamarama is famous for its laidback vibe, fantastic surf and spectacular properties but it's incredibly rare to find a beach house in this exclusive enclave that has a lush established garden at the front and at the rear. One of a few remaining freestanding 1920s bungalows, the aptly named Mackenzies View rests on a level 445sqm on the doorstep of Tamarama Beach with a wide side drive and triple parking another rarity for this tightly held stretch of the eastern coast.
With only ever a handful of owners, the double-fronted Californian bungalow is spread over two levels with a family focused layout and a stylish beach house aesthetic designed for barefoot beachside living. Introduced by a wide foyer, the four-bedroom home features free-flowing living areas leading out to a gorgeous private garden with loads of space to relax, play and entertain alfresco. Capturing ocean views from the upper level, this beachside beauty is around the corner from Fletcher Street's cafe hub and an easy 350m stroll to the sand and surf.

About Tamarama 2026

The size of Tamarama is approximately 0.3 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 28.5% of total area. The population of Tamarama in 2011 was 1,450 people. By 2016 the population was 1,598 showing a population growth of 10.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tamarama is 30-39 years. Households in Tamarama are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tamarama work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 45.8% of the homes in Tamarama were owner-occupied compared with 50.5% in 2016.

Tamarama has 970 properties.
